ADH stands for antidiuretic hormone, also known as vasopressin. It is a hormone produced by the hypothalamus and released by the pituitary gland. ADH plays a role in regulating the amount of water reabsorbed by the kidneys, and helps to control the concentration of urine.

ADH, or antidiuretic hormone, helps regulate water balance by increasing water reabsorption in the kidneys. This hormone helps to concentrate urine and maintain fluid balance in the body by reducing urine output. If ADH levels are too low, it can lead to increased urination and dehydration.

The gland that secretes antidiuretic hormone (ADH), also known as vasopressin, is the posterior pituitary gland. ADH is synthesized in the hypothalamus and then transported to the posterior pituitary, where it is released into the bloodstream. This hormone plays a crucial role in regulating water balance in the body by promoting water reabsorption in the kidneys.
